Output d6fc4c1b63aba1fbea82a8e2f30607af863b94687ec7ede323b63fca4d67df6e:0

value
12400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ffe2da78fb9653445a3aee5de9e28d35e8015f OP_EQUAL
address
3KU5Z3GkD7r1TsND1KgqdPwoDkbyHpXqGn
transaction
d6fc4c1b63aba1fbea82a8e2f30607af863b94687ec7ede323b63fca4d67df6e
spent
true